Study Notes
National Semiconductor Mission of India
-
Objective: To establish India as a global hub for semiconductor design and manufacturing.
-
Launch Year: 2021
-
Investment: The government allocated approximately $10 billion to boost the semiconductor ecosystem.
-
Key Components:
- Design: Support for semiconductor design companies and research institutions.
- Manufacturing: Incentives for setting up fabrication (fab) facilities in India.
- Packaging and Testing: Focus on enhancing capabilities in semiconductor packaging and testing.
-
Goals:
- Increase domestic production of semiconductors to reduce dependency on imports.
- Create a sustainable ecosystem for research, innovation, and development in semiconductor technology.
- Foster partnerships with global semiconductor players to leverage expertise and technology.
-
Implementation Strategy:
- Policy Framework: Development of conducive policies and regulations to attract investments.
- Financial Support: Providing financial incentives and subsidies for semiconductor-related projects.
- Skill Development: Initiatives to train and develop a skilled workforce in semiconductor technologies.
-
Expected Outcomes:
- Enhanced self-reliance in semiconductor manufacturing.
- Creation of new jobs and economic growth in the electronics sector.
- Strengthened position in the global semiconductor supply chain.
-
Challenges:
- High initial capital investment required for fabs.
- Competition from established semiconductor hubs globally.
- Need for a robust supply chain and infrastructure development.
